TypeScript
import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as outputs from "../types/output";
/**
 * Get a SuppressionList resource.
 *
 * Uses Azure REST API version 2023-06-01-preview.
 *
 * Other available API versions: 2024-09-01-preview, 2025-05-01-preview. These can be accessed by generating a local SDK package using the CLI command `pulumi package add azure-native communication [ApiVersion]`. See the [version guide](../../../version-guide/#accessing-any-api-version-via-local-packages) for details.
 */
export declare function getSuppressionList(args: GetSuppressionListArgs, opts?: pulumi.InvokeOptions): Promise<GetSuppressionListResult>;
export interface GetSuppressionListArgs {
    /**
     * The name of the Domains resource.
     */
    domainName: string;
    /**
     * The name of the EmailService resource.
     */
    emailServiceName: string;
    /**
     * The name of the resource group. The name is case insensitive.
     */
    resourceGroupName: string;
    /**
     * The name of the suppression list.
     */
    suppressionListName: string;
}
/**
 * A class representing a SuppressionList resource.
 */
export interface GetSuppressionListResult {
    /**
     * The Azure API version of the resource.
     */
    readonly azureApiVersion: string;
    /**
     * The date the resource was created.
     */
    readonly createdTimeStamp: string;
    /**
     * The location where the SuppressionListAddress data is stored at rest. This value is inherited from the parent Domains resource.
     */
    readonly dataLocation: string;
    /**
     * Fully qualified resource ID for the resource. E.g. "/sub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/{resourceProviderNamespace}/{resourceType}/{resourceName}"
     */
    readonly id: string;
    /**
     * The date the resource was last updated.
     */
    readonly lastUpdatedTimeStamp: string;
    /**
     * The the name of the suppression list. This value must match one of the valid sender usernames of the sending domain.
     */
    readonly listName?: string;
    /**
     * The name of the resource
     */
    readonly name: string;
    /**
     * Azure Resource Manager metadata containing createdBy and modifiedBy information.
     */
    readonly systemData: outputs.communication.SystemDataResponse;
    /**
     * The type of the resource. E.g. "Microsoft.Compute/virtualMachines" or "Microsoft.Storage/storageAccounts"
     */
    readonly type: string;
}
